| Abstract | In this paper the current harmonic can be compensated by using the Shunt Active Power Filter, the Passive Power Filter and the combination of both. The system has the function of voltage stability, and harmonic suppression. The reference current can be calculated by using a new control algorithm by using three phase hybrid shunt Active power. An improved Control algorithm is proposed to improve the Performance of APF. The simulation results of the Non-linear systems have been carried out with MATLAB 7.6. |
